كيفية تحويل ملفات PLT إلى Excel بكفاءة باستخدام GroupDocs.Conversion لـ .NET
مقدمة
هل تواجه صعوبة في تحويل ملفات PLT إلى صيغة أسهل للإدارة مثل Excel؟ تُبسّط مكتبة GroupDocs.Conversion هذه المهمة. سيرشدك هذا البرنامج التعليمي خلال عملية تحويل ملفات PLT إلى صيغة XLS باستخدام GroupDocs.Conversion لـ .NET.
- الكلمة الرئيسية الأساسية:تحويل PLT إلى Excel باستخدام GroupDocs.Conversion
- الكلمات الرئيسية الثانوية:تحويل ملفات PLT، تحويل البيانات في .NET، تحويل تنسيق الملف
ما سوف تتعلمه:
- إعداد البيئة الخاصة بك باستخدام GroupDocs.Conversion.
- تحميل وتحويل ملف PLT إلى Excel (XLS).
- تحسين الأداء للتحويلات واسعة النطاق.
المتطلبات الأساسية
قبل أن نبدأ، تأكد من أن لديك ما يلي:
المكتبات والتبعيات المطلوبة
- GroupDocs.Conversion:الإصدار 25.3.0 أو أحدث.
- .NET Framework (4.6.1 أو أعلى) أو .NET Core.
متطلبات إعداد البيئة
- تم تثبيت Visual Studio مع بيئة تطوير C#.
- فهم أساسي لعمليات إدخال وإخراج الملفات في C#.
إعداد GroupDocs.Conversion لـ .NET
لاستخدام GroupDocs.Conversion، قم أولاً بتثبيته باستخدام NuGet Package Manager أو .NET CLI:
وحدة تحكم مدير الحزم NuGet
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ET CLI
dotnet add package GroupDocs.Conversion --version 25.3.0
خطوات الحصول على الترخيص
- نسخة تجريبية مجانية:تحميل نسخة تجريبية من موقع GroupDocs.
- رخصة مؤقتة:تقدم بطلب للحصول على ترخيص مؤقت من خلالهم صفحة الشراء.
- شراء:للاستخدام طويل الأمد، قم بشراء ترخيص على صفحة الشراء.
التهيئة والإعداد الأساسي
فيما يلي كيفية تهيئة GroupDocs.Conversion في مشروع C# الخاص بك:
using System;
using System.IO;
using GroupDocs.Conversion;
using GroupDocs.Conversion.Options.Convert;
// تحديد مسارات لدلائل الإدخال والإخراج
const string DocumentDirectory = "YOUR_DOCUMENT_DIRECTORY";
const string OutputDirectory = "YOUR_OUTPUT_DIRECTORY";
// إنشاء مثيل جديد لفئة المحول من خلال توفير مسار ملف المصدر
string sourceFile = Path.Combine(DocumentDirectory, "sample.plt");
using (var converter = new Converter(sourceFile))
{
// سيتم إضافة منطق التحويل هنا
}
دليل التنفيذ
تحميل وتحويل PLT إلى XLS
ملخص
في هذا القسم، سنقوم بتحميل ملف PLT وتحويله إلى تنسيق Excel باستخدام GroupDocs.Conversion.
الخطوة 1: تحميل ملف المصدر
string sourceFile = Path.Combine(DocumentDirectory, "sample.plt");
تحدد هذه الخطوة المسار إلى ملف PLT الخاص بك.
الخطوة 2: تعيين خيارات التحويل
SpreadsheetConvertOptions options = new SpreadsheetConvertOptions { Format = SpreadsheetFileType.Xls };
هنا، نقوم بتحديد إعدادات التحويل من خلال تحديد تنسيق الإخراج الذي يجب أن يكون XLS.
الخطوة 3: تنفيذ التحويل
string outputFile = Path.Combine(OutputDirectory, "plt-converted-to.xls");
converter.Convert(outputFile, options);
تؤدي هذه الخطوة إلى تنفيذ عملية التحويل وحفظ النتيجة في الدليل المخصص لك.
نصائح استكشاف الأخطاء وإصلاحها
- مشكلة شائعة: خطأ عدم العثور على الملف. تأكد من
DocumentDirectory
يحتوي على المسار الصحيح لملف PLT الخاص بك. - حل:تحقق جيدًا من جميع مسارات الملفات وتأكد من تحديدها بشكل صحيح.
التطبيقات العملية
- إنشاء التقارير تلقائيًا:أتمتة تحويل ملفات التصميم للتقارير المالية.
- تكامل تحليل البيانات:التكامل بسلاسة مع أدوات تحليل البيانات التي تتطلب تنسيقات Excel.
- أنظمة الأرشيف:تحويل ملفات PLT القديمة إلى تنسيق Excel الحديث لتحقيق توافق أفضل.
- الأدوات التعليمية:استخدامها في البرامج التعليمية حيث يقوم الطلاب بتحميل أوراق البيانات المحولة والعمل عليها.
اعتبارات الأداء
- تحسين إدخال/إخراج الملفات:تقليل عمليات الوصول إلى الملفات عن طريق تحويل الدفعات عندما يكون ذلك ممكنًا.
- إدارة الذاكرة:تخلص من الأشياء بشكل صحيح بعد الاستخدام، وخاصة داخل
using
كتل لتحرير الموارد بكفاءة. - معالجة الدفعات:بالنسبة للكميات الكبيرة، خذ بعين الاعتبار معالجة الملفات على دفعات لإدارة استهلاك الذاكرة.
خاتمة
لديك الآن المعرفة لتحويل ملفات PLT إلى XLS باستخدام GroupDocs.Conversion لـ .NET. يمكن دمج هذه الأداة الفعّالة في تطبيقات متنوعة، مما يُحسّن توافق البيانات وكفاءة سير العمل.
الخطوات التالية
- قم بتجربة تنسيقات الملفات المختلفة التي يدعمها GroupDocs.Conversion.
- استكشف الميزات المتقدمة مثل المعالجة الدفعية أو التكامل السحابي.
دعوة إلى العمل:حاول تنفيذ هذا الحل في مشروعك التالي لتبسيط عملية تحويل الملفات الخاصة بك!
قسم الأسئلة الشائعة
ما هو ملف PLT؟
- يحتوي ملف PLT (الرسم التخطيطي) على بيانات متجهية تستخدمها تطبيقات CAD للرسم التخطيطي.
كيف يمكنني استكشاف أخطاء التحويلات الفاشلة وإصلاحها؟
- تحقق من مسارات الملفات وتأكد من تثبيت كافة التبعيات بشكل صحيح.
هل يمكن أتمتة عملية التحويل هذه بكميات كبيرة؟
- نعم، يمكنك أتمتة العملية باستخدام نصوص الدفعات أو دمجها في سير عمل أكبر.
ما هي التنسيقات الأخرى التي يدعمها GroupDocs.Conversion؟
- إنه يدعم أكثر من 50 تنسيقًا مختلفًا للمستندات بما في ذلك PDF وWord وExcel والمزيد.
هل هناك تأثير على الأداء عند تحويل الملفات الكبيرة؟
- قد يختلف الأداء وفقًا لموارد النظام؛ لذا فكر في تحسين بيئتك لتحقيق كفاءة أفضل.
موارد
- التوثيق
- مرجع واجهة برمجة التطبيقات
- تحميل
- شراء GroupDocs.Conversion
- نسخة تجريبية مجانية
- رخصة مؤقتة
- منتدى الدعم
بفضل هذا الدليل الشامل، ستكون مجهزًا بشكل جيد لبدء استخدام GroupDocs.Conversion لـ .NET لتحويل ملفات PLT إلى تنسيق Excel بسهولة!